Quote (UniKorn @ Mar. 09 2004, 10:26 am)
I'm not following here either tbh wolf. Areaportals are used to prevent stuff being drawn when a door is closed, while what Speed means is that you can see other area's of a map through the skybox (aka skybox bug)

i realise that :)
but whenever i've had the skybox bug happen to me i've used areaportals to block off that area from the area showing through the skybox. it works. basically the skybox will show (in certain circumstances) parts of the map behind the skybox. but if you prevent them being drawn by the use of areaportals it will also prevent the skybox bug from being able to show them.

as i said it happens in voy1. when i was making alert (jeez thats a lonnnngggg time ago now :) ) i had this happen. i ended up having 2 sets of doors in the ready room to ensure that it would always be closed off from the part of the map behind the skybox. it worked. it no longer had the bug.

I'd stick to using hint brushes and watch your vis data, if you can see another part of your map only through the skybox and not by walking a few metres either way then you should nearly always be able to block it off using hint brushes to tidy up the vis data.
